SPDR Blackstone Senior Loan ETF

193 hedge funds and large institutions have $1.13B invested in SPDR Blackstone Senior Loan ETF in 2020 Q1 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 27 funds opening new positions, 61 increasing their positions, 85 reducing their positions, and 48 closing their positions.
